Tree protection standards which apply to any development or redevelopment meeting certain standards, including all sites proposed for development. Establishes “Tree Density Units” (TDUs) as a method of measuring volume of required tree planting on-site based on new impervious surface or zoning classification. Existing trees may be counted to achieve required TDUs.
Includes the following provisions:
– Requirements for tree planting in and around parking lots based on lot size
– Tree Density Standards based on Zoning District
